Whether there is a big difference between 16g and 32g memory depends on the user's specific evaluation criteria. Generally speaking, there is not much difference between 16g and 32g memory. Their differences mainly lie in different gaming experiences, different experiences when opening multiple programs, different rendering speeds, different storage capacities, etc.
1. Different gaming experience
16g memory can meet the needs of large-scale games, but it cannot enable high image quality and high frame rate. The 32G memory can run large games smoothly and the gaming experience is better.
2. The experience of opening multiple programs is different
If you open multiple programs on a computer with 16g memory, the system will get stuck and the program will be automatically killed in the background, so only Suitable for daily use at home. 32G memory can open more than a dozen or even dozens of programs, making it suitable for studio use.
3. Different rendering speeds
When a computer with 16g memory faces complex scenes, its rendering speed is slower. The 32g memory has larger memory, the computer has more space to store temporary data, and the rendering speed is naturally faster.
4. Different storage capacities

How to purchase memory:
1. The workmanship must be excellent
The most important thing when choosing memory is stability And performance, and the workmanship level of the memory will directly affect the performance, stability and overclocking. The quality of memory particles directly affects the performance of the memory. It can be said that it is also the most important core component of the memory. Therefore, when purchasing, try to choose memory chips produced by major manufacturers.
2. SPD hidden information
SPD information can be said to be very important. It can intuitively reflect the performance and system of the memory. It stores indicator information that the memory can work stably, as well as product production, manufacturer and other information.
3. Fake reworked products
Currently, some memories often use different brands and models of memory particles, and then print new serial number parameters. However, if you look closely, you will find that the polished chip is dull and has a fluffy feel, and the printed writing is blurry and unclear. These are generally counterfeit memory products, so be careful.
